Responsibilities

  • Managing the service desk mailbox and chat channels, ensuring timely responses and directing queries to the right people
  • Resolving first-line IT questions and escalating more complex technical issues as needed (coordinating with external IT partner)
  • Supporting the onboarding and offboarding processes for employees
  • Coordinating the seamless execution of in-house events, such as regional and global presentations, team celebrations, and client visits
  • Contributing to other Workspace Management initiatives or projects, such as annual anniversary celebrations (SKIMday), office renovations, and Health, Safety & Environment (HSE) initiatives
  • Maintaining the physical workspace of the Rotterdam office (140 employees) and supporting London (25 employees), Paris (5 employees), Berlin (20 employees), and Singapore (20 employees) offices
  • Serving as the first point of contact for employee queries globally (via chat and email) during Dutch office hours

About SKIMS

SKIMS designs and produces underwear, loungewear, and shapewear that cater to a variety of body types. Their products are made to be comfortable while enhancing the natural shape of the wearer. The product line includes shapewear, stretchable underwear, and versatile loungewear, all aimed at modern consumers who value comfort and functionality. SKIMS primarily sells its products directly to customers through its website, allowing for better control over branding and customer experience. This direct-to-consumer approach helps the company maintain higher profit margins by eliminating middlemen. SKIMS stands out in the market by focusing on inclusivity and offering a wide range of sizes and styles, making it appealing to individuals looking for stylish and comfortable undergarments. The company's goal is to set new standards in the apparel industry by providing high-quality, comfortable clothing that meets the needs of diverse consumers.
